It is hereby notified that the examinations for LL.B. (3-YDC) IV-Semester & LL.B (5-YDC) IV, VIII-Semesters (Regular, Ex & Improvement) will be held in August, 2019 and that the schedule for payment of prescribed examination fee and submission of downloaded NRs and Photo-forms to the undersigned is as follows:
Last date for the Candidates :
Without late fee : 12-07-2019
With a late fee of Rs.250/- : 17-07-2019
Payment of Prescribed Fee :
For all Papers : Rs. 930/-
Up to two (2) Papers : Rs. 400/-
Improvement for each paper : Rs. 300/-
Instructions to the Candidates:
The Candidates have to verify and confirm their eligibility as per the academic norms before remittance of examination fee and submission of their applications, along with a copy of the memo of marks of qualifying examination, to their Principal of the College concerned for uploading their examination form(s) through online to www.kakatiya.ac.in.
Fee once remitted will not be refunded or adjusted under any circumstances.
However, the appearance in the examinations by the candidates will be subject to eligibility and promotion norms. In case of deviation of norms, such candidates shall forego the results of the examinations to be appeared.
